Day of Remembrance for Egil Skallagrimsson




Perhaps the best known Odin's man from the Saga age. Egil was born from a line of berserks and shape shifters. Egil's life was defined by his violent outbursts, his devotion to Odinn, and his skaldcraft.

Egil rubbed shoulders with kings and queens, set up nidpoles, fought numerous battles, and was a skilled poet and rune worker. Late in life he experienced the death of his sons.... that was his lowest point. He cried out in his poem, Sonatorrek, for the loss of his son and his anger with his patron, Odinn.

Egil led a life that was well lived to say the least.
